Key Insights

  • A man died in Letterkenny, northwest Ireland, in a weather-related incident.
  • Over 200,000 properties in Ireland and Northern Ireland were without power.
  • A gust of 96 mph (154 kph) was recorded on the island of Tiree, off Scotland’s west coast.
  • Royal Parks in London were closed due to severe wind gusts.
  • Tens of thousands of homes in Scandinavia lost power.

In-Depth Analysis

Storm Amy, named jointly by the U.K., Irish, and Dutch weather agencies, impacted a large area of Northern Europe. The storm brought down trees and power lines, causing widespread power outages and travel disruptions. In Scotland, ferry services were suspended, and roads and railway lines were blocked by fallen trees. London’s Royal Parks, popular with locals and tourists, were closed for the day due to severe wind gusts. The storm also wreaked havoc on Sweden, Denmark, and Norway, with heavy rainfall and high tides affecting coastal areas.
